Copy_paste:

it is just 220 pounds and how could it travel so far and so long...what is the source to keep it running?




short answer gravity


long answer, with every swing by of a celestial object it gains speed due to momentum captured from the object. Once it reaches the right trajectory, rockets fire to separate it from the orbit and launch it to the next swing by
